The Collierville Dragons earned a 72-63 win over the Memphis Academy of Science and Engineering Phoenix on Thursday. That's two games straight that the Dragons have won by exactly nine points.
Leading Collierville to victory were Christian Coleman and Rashad Johnson. Coleman posted 21 points in addition to eight boards and six assists, while Johnson had 11 points.
Collierville has started the season off flawlessly and has a 2-0 record to show for it. The victories came thanks in part to their offensive performance across that stretch, as they've averaged 67.5 points this season. As for Memphis Academy of Science and Engineering, their loss dropped their record down to 1-1.
Collierville and Memphis Academy of Science and Engineering will both get a bit of extra prep time before their next matchups. The next time the Dragons see the court they'll take on Briarcrest Christian at 7:30 p.m. on December 2. As for Memphis Academy of Science and Engineering, their break will end when they face Wooddale at 12:00 p.m. on December 2.
